New Delhi : Cambodian Prime Minister Hun Sen arrives here on a four-day state visit Saturday, during which he will also visit Hyderabad to see the Hitech City and a rural development institute.
The prime minister was earlier in Delhi in July but his visit had to be cancelled a couple of hours after he landed in Delhi due to declaration of a state mourning over the death of former prime minister Chandra Shekhar.
Hun Sen is accompanied by two deputy prime ministers and ministers for commerce, water resources and agriculture.
On Saturday, he will call on President Pratibha Patil and hold discussions with Prime Minister Manmohan Singh in the evening. He will also address a business luncheon meeting jointly organised by three major business chambers.
He will leave for Hyderabad on Sunday.
